The Papers of Professor Joan Violet Robinson

Title Letter from Gunnar Myrdal to Joan Robinson, with several papers
Reference JVR/7/308
Creator Myrdal, Gunnar (1898-1987)
Covering Dates 1972–1978
Extent and Medium 2 envelopes; paper
Content and context

Gunnar Myrdal was affiliated with the Institute for International Economic Studies, Stockholm.

His correspondence comprises:

1 letter thanking Joan Robinson for a perceptive review.

1 change of address slip.

10 typescript papers, including:

'An American Dilemma-Has It Been Resolved?'. 1972.

'Growth and Social Justice'. 1972.

'A Contribution Towards a More Realistic Theory of Economic Growth and Development'. 1972.

'Toward a New America'. 1972.

'Economics of an improved Environment'. 1972.

'Preface to the New Swedish Edition 1972'. 1971, English version 1977.

'A Parallel: The First Blum Government 1936'. 1977.

'The Tom Slick Colloquium 10 March 1978: Opening Statement by Gunnar Myrdal'.

'[Ibid.: address] The Risks of increasing Militarization', by Alva Myrdal.

'Need for Reforms in Underdeveloped Countries'. 1978.
